Strawberry Yogurt Pudding /Eggless Baked Pudding / Without thickening agents

Ingredients:
Strawberry - 6-8 medium sized chopped
Yogurt-  1 cup ( Go for whole milk to get creamy texture)
Full fat fresh cream - 1 cup (Cut down with whole milk or half and half)
Condensed milk  - 1 cup
Vanilla essence - 1 tsp
Boiling water - 2 -3 cups (for the water bath)

Method:

Blend the strawberry into really smooth paste without adding water.
Blend the yogurt, cream and condensed milk too . Mix the strawberry blended into the yogurt mixture mix until combined.
Pour into individual ramekins or into a loaf pan. (Do not grease moulds)
Take a large baking dish and pour the boiling water into it carefully and keep the ramekins or loaf pan into this large baking dish.Take care so the ramekins  does not submerge.
Bake at 350 F for 20-25 minutes until the top is firm yet jiggly on touch. (Do not let edges brown or burn)
Remove ramekins or loaf pan  from water bath .Allow it cool at room temp.
Refrigerate upto a day and decorate as desired while serving.
This dessert can be served warm or chilled too.

Note : The  sourness/tartness of the yogurt and the strawberry affects the texture you are looking in the dessert. So pick sweet berries and no so sour but fresh yogurt for the recipe.
